Comparability Of Performance Of A Quantity Of Cpu Architectures
Be conscious that architectures, caches, and interconnects profoundly impact these outcomes, as all of these factors impression how well efficiency scales with extra threads. It additionally depends heavily upon how nicely the software program scales with additional compute cores. As such, these results do not align perfectly based upon core/thread depend, though it does serve as a good litmus of multi-threaded performance.

Next on the totem pole is the Snapdragon 780G. Released early in 2021, the 780G has the identical 5nm design as the Snapdragon 888 in addition to a triple-tiered CPU design. You’re taking a glance at one Cortex-A78 CPU clocked at 2.4GHz, three Cortex-A78 CPUs clocked at 2.2GHz, and cpu compare 4 Cortex-A55 CPU cores. In other words, you’ve got sufficient CPU energy to take it to older flagship processors.

Most small companies ought to avoid tiered credit card processor pricing, which bundles the interchange rate, evaluation fees and markup into one pricing plan. Because the costs are bundled, it’s tough to tell how much you’re paying for every merchandise. Unless the seller is willing to break out its fees, it’s greatest to avoid a tiered pricing structure.
